Product description

The essentials

If you’re trying to make a child’s room feel more comfortable for daytime naps or calmer evenings, room-darkening curtains can make a noticeable difference. The BellaHills 100% blackout curtains are designed as standard-size drapes with a pencil pleat top, sold as a set of two panels. Over the paper, their pitch is straightforward: reduce light, help with privacy, and limit UV entering the room, while also giving you a clean, modern look.

Just keep in mind that “100% blackout” is usually the kind of claim that depends on how your window is fitted (gaps around the frame matter). Still, these are set up specifically for light reducing and privacy protection, and they include tie backs, which is handy if you want daylight in some parts of the day without opening everything up.

Key features that affect day-to-day use

These are blackout-style panels aimed at kids’ rooms and nurseries. The base description says they can block 50% to 100% of sunlight and prevent 100% UV rays, and that they’re vinyl free. It also flags durable yarn and a noise reducing, energy-saving/efficiency angle—so the expectation is not only darker room conditions, but also a bit more comfort.

A practical detail that matters for styling and fit: they’re sold as two panels, and each panel is W66" x D54". The set measures W132" x D54". For proper fullness, you’re advised that panels should measure about 2–3 times the width of your window. If your window is narrower than the “fullness” guidance suggests, they may look more tight than lush.

What stands out (and what to watch)

Where these curtains stand out is the combination of blackout intent and a ready-to-hang format. Pencil pleat tops tend to suit most standard curtain track and rail setups, and the included tie backs make it easier to let light in when needed.

However, there are a couple of buying limits to weigh up. First, the light-blocking performance is described as a range (50% to 100%), so you shouldn’t assume the result will be identical in every room or with every window layout. Second, short drapes can be great for kid’s rooms—less fuss lower down—but if you want a fully floor-to-ceiling, “cinema” effect, you may find these are not quite what you’re picturing.

Best use cases for this curtain set

These BellaHills blackout panels look most at home where you want gentler light control: a nursery that benefits from reduced glare, a kids’ bedroom where evening wind-down matters, or a playroom where you want privacy when blinds are not enough. For a micro example: imagine closing the curtains before a nap, then pulling them back using the tie backs for story time after—small change, but it can shift the whole feel of the room.

In terms of home style, the description positions them as classic yet modern-leaning, suitable for contemporary, traditional, vintage rustic, and Victorian styles. So if you’re aiming for something that doesn’t look overly “nursery-only”, these can fit more than one direction.

Materials, care, and maintenance reality check

Care is fairly simple on paper. They’re described as machine or hand washable, with no bleaching and low ironing. That matters because kids’ rooms can get… messy. It’s not perfect if you’re expecting no-effort care, but the low-iron angle is a sensible compromise for everyday life.

Also note the advice to measure your pole and window size before choosing. Curtain sizing is where a lot of disappointment comes from, so it’s worth doing properly rather than relying on a generic “it should fit”.

Who it’s for (and who should skip it)

It makes sense if you want a practical blackout-style solution for a kid’s room and you care about reducing glare and improving privacy without going for something complicated. You’ll also likely like this approach if you’re after short, tidy curtains with pencil pleat styling and an easy-use “tie backs in, tie backs out” routine.

You may want to skip it if your priority is maximum light elimination with minimal gaps around the window, or if you’re chasing a full-length look down to the floor. It might not be a great match if your window width means you can’t reach the recommended 2–3 times fullness, because the final drape can end up looking less full than expected.

Will these curtains completely block light?

The description mentions they can block 50% to 100% sunlight, so results can vary depending on your window and how the panels sit. If you want near-total darkness, fit and coverage matter.

How are the curtains hung?

They use a pencil pleated top, and the set is sold with tie backs. The listing also advises measuring your pole and window size first.

Are they washable?

Yes—machine or hand washable is stated, with no bleaching and low ironing.

What size do I need for my window?

Each panel is W66" x D54" and the set is W132" x D54". For proper fullness, panels should be 2–3 times the window width.

How many panels are included?

Two panels are included in the set, and the set has two tie backs.
